Full Job Posting
- Clarify and document customer operational requirements, training objectives, and material levels.
- Aid in prioritizing requirements for training development.
- Conduct research utilizing classified and unclassified domain-specific resources to source authentic language content.
- Develop training materials encompassing transcription, translation, and analysis of operational, task-based exercises as necessary.
- Collaborate with instructors, government stakeholders, and contractor developers to design, develop, and document domain-specific training materials.
- Utilize technology such as Audacity, Adobe Creative Suite, and Adobe Premier to create blended learning experiences.
- Collaborate with SIGINT Operations technical experts and other stakeholders to acquire and refine training materials.
- Design practical evaluations to assess student mastery of learning objectives.
- Identify and recommend learning applications and tools to enhance training delivery.
- Work closely with government and contractor instructors and developers to achieve training objectives.
- Current TS/SCI + Full Scope Polygraph: In-scope counterintelligence polygraphs will be accepted, while personnel possessing a current CI polygraph will be considered for a contract position that requires a full-scope polygraph if they possess a Conditional Certification of Access (CCA) pending the successful completion and adjudication of a full-scope polygraph.
- Bachelor’s degree in Language, Area Studies, Education, Educational Technology, ISD, Intelligence, or a directly related discipline, OR four additional years of applied, practical experience in education, instructional design, or relevant analysis fields for a total of nine years of work experience.
- One year of experience in instructional systems design within the last four years, including synchronous and asynchronous delivery methods and skills-based instruction for adults using web-based or distance learning technologies (e.g., Centra, Blackboard, Questionmark, SumTotal).
- Minimum of nine (9) years of experience, which must include: Five (5) years of SIGINT or Intelligence Community experience as an Intelligence Analyst and three (3) years experience, within the last ten (10) years, of applied practical experience developing, documenting and/or updating basic, intermediate, or advanced training materials following the principles of ISD.
